The scope of this work extends far beyond traditional rhetorical modes, offering a highly flexible framework centered on critical cognitive habits. Richard E. Miller and Ann Jurecic guide readers through essential practices such as learning how to look closely, asking generative questions, and persisting through intellectual difficulty. Rather than presenting writing as a linear series of steps, the authors treat it as an ongoing, active conversation with the surrounding world. This approach teaches students to view reading and writing as deeply interconnected acts of exploration, allowing them to engage thoughtfully with complex cultural, social, and political issues while developing their own unique analytical voices.
Designed primarily for introductory college writing courses, Habits of the Creative Mind 3rd Edition is widely adopted by instructors seeking to cultivate critical thinking and intellectual resilience in their classrooms. This updated version introduces refreshed practice sessions that explore multilingualism, identity, and modern communication, alongside six contemporary readings addressing urgent societal topics.
